iPhone and Touch get firmware upgrade to 2.2



Joshua Schnell | Fri, Nov 21, 2008


It was only a matter of time before the firmware patch dropped on us. It’s been in the rumor mill for over a week. The rumors were right. Street View is now available on the iPhone, but for some reason Touch users get left out in the cold. I guess it makes sense, considering you can’t navigate the streets with your Touch, unless you’re hoping from open access point to open access point. We now get the ability to get our podcasts over edge/3g or wifi, which comes as a bit of relief. You also now have the ability to turn auto-correction off, this isn’t an excuse for you to throw spelling to the wind. Don’t be that guy!
